The Oversoul Prayer is a recitation appealing to the highest expression of each of our individual souls. Written by Karen Kohler in Brooklyn, NY in June of 2018, this prayer-poem was inspired by the American Indian (Lakota) prayer of Chief Yellow Lark, titled "O' Great Spirit" of 1887. Karen drew the name "Oversoul" from an 1841 essay by Ralph Waldo Emerson, and from the name of an inspirational painting by the artist Alex Grey.

Transcript

Oh great Oversoul,

Whose breath fills my lungs and whose voice I hear in the space between heartbeats,

Hear me.

I am small and delicate.

I appeal to your grandeur and strength.

Open my eyes that I may behold beauty in all the ways that are true.

And clench my fists that I may ready my hands for holding.

Tune my spine that I may move effortlessly with wind,

Creature and water.

Make my lungs supple that they may feed from your fire without burning and feed you in return.

Steady my mind that it may align with the signal you send and receive.

Calm my heart that it may bloom freely into your highest knowing.

Soften my belly that it may harbor the lessons you leave me under every leaf and stone.

Center my seat that it may seal in your everlasting joy of becoming.

Awaken my voice that I will recognize its luster when you sound the call.

I seek strength not to defeat myself but to align with the servant forces with which to lift myself up toward you.

Make me always ready to come to you with clear eyes,

Open hands and a willing heart.

Help me to die each day with the setting sun and to be born each night with a rising moon.

So when at last my light fades,

I may come to you in love and common purpose as you lead me over.
